var max_m=6;
var menu_hover = new Array(max_m);
var menu = new Array(max_m);
var separator = new Array(3);

function preload_menu()
{
	for (i=0;i<max_m;i++) {
		menu_hover[i]=new Image();
		menu[i]=new Image();
	}
	for (i=0;i<3;i++) {
		separator[i]=new Array(3);
		for (j=0;j<3;j++) separator[i][j]=new Image();
	}
	var dir='img/';
	menu_hover[0].src=dir+'mp_home_d.gif';
	menu_hover[1].src=dir+'mp_leistung_d.gif';
	menu_hover[2].src=dir+'mp_methoden_d.gif';
	menu_hover[3].src=dir+'mp_aktuell_d.gif';
	menu_hover[4].src=dir+'mp_minis_d.gif';
	menu_hover[5].src=dir+'mp_kontakt_d.gif';
	menu[0].src=dir+'mp_home.gif';
	menu[1].src=dir+'mp_leistung.gif';
	menu[2].src=dir+'mp_methoden.gif';
	menu[3].src=dir+'mp_aktuell.gif';
	menu[4].src=dir+'mp_minis.gif';
	menu[5].src=dir+'mp_kontakt.gif';
	separator[0][0].src=dir+'left_edge_d.gif';
	separator[0][2].src=dir+'left_edge.gif';
	separator[1][0].src=dir+'separator_01.gif';
	separator[1][1].src=dir+'separator_10.gif';
	separator[1][2].src=dir+'separator_norm.gif';
	separator[2][1].src=dir+'right_edge_d.gif';
	separator[2][2].src=dir+'right_edge.gif';
}

function get_sep_idx(point)
{
	if ((point>0) && (point<max_m)) return 1;else
		if (point==max_m) return 2;else return 0;
}

function swap_home(point, over)
{
	if (over) {
		document.images["mp"+point].src=menu_hover[point].src;
		document.images["sep"+point].src=separator[get_sep_idx(point)][0].src;
		document.images["sep"+(++point)].src=separator[get_sep_idx(point)][1].src;
	}
	else {
		document.images["mp"+point].src=menu[point].src;
		document.images["sep"+point].src=separator[get_sep_idx(point)][2].src;
		document.images["sep"+(++point)].src=separator[get_sep_idx(point)][2].src;
	}
}

preload_menu();
